A Chalet in Hollywood Light
The Gradonna gained international attention as a filming location for the Amazon Prime series Nine Perfect Strangers. One of the chalets became the mysterious retreat of Nicole Kidman’s character, Mascha Dmitrichenko. While the Hollywood star herself never filmed on-site, the resort’s presence throughout the series lends it an unmistakable cinematic aura.
A Stage for Film and Television
The Gradonna also shines in European cinema. In the Austrian-German comedy Der Spitzname, it features alongside the Großglockner Resort Kals-Matrei ski area, setting the stage for Iris Berben, Christoph Maria Herbst, and Florian David Fitz. The resort has likewise served as a backdrop for series such as Die Bergretter and Landkrimi.
